CRM Basic
  • July 29, 2025

CRM vs. ERP: Know the Differences

crm-vs-erp

Customer Relationship Management (CRM) and Enterprise Resource Planning (ERP) are powerful enterprise software tools that help organizations streamline and enhance their business operations. Both systems are designed to integrate data across departments and reduce reliance on manual processes by automating routine tasks. Although they share some overlapping features and benefits, CRM and ERP serve different strategic purposes and are not interchangeable.

CRM systems focus on front-office activities that involve direct customer interaction—such as sales, marketing, customer support, and relationship management. Their primary goal is to boost customer satisfaction and drive revenue growth by improving how companies engage with their clients. ERP systems, in contrast, are geared toward back-office functions like accounting, human resources, procurement, inventory, and supply chain management. They aim to increase operational efficiency and ensure consistency across internal processes.

Understanding the unique roles and advantages of CRM and ERP can help you determine which system—or combination of both—is best suited for your business goals. Read on to explore their core benefits, key differences, and how they can work together to support long-term growth.

What Is CRM? (Customer Relationship Management)

Customer Relationship Management (CRM) refers to a strategy, process, and set of technologies that organizations use to manage and analyze interactions with current and potential customers. The primary goal of CRM is to improve customer relationships, enhance customer retention, and drive sales growth by organizing and automating customer-facing activities.

Key Functions of a CRM System

A CRM system serves as a centralized platform that helps teams manage:

  • Contact Information – Storing and updating customer details in one place

  • Sales Pipeline – Tracking leads, opportunities, and deals through the sales cycle

  • Marketing Automation – Running and measuring targeted email or ad campaigns

  • Customer Service – Managing support tickets, inquiries, and service history

  • Analytics & Reporting – Gaining insights from customer data to inform decision-making

CRM Benefits

Here’s a detailed list of the benefits of CRM (Customer Relationship Management) systems, broken down into specific, actionable advantages:

Improved Customer Relationships : CRM systems provide a 360-degree view of each customer, including their contact history, preferences, interactions, and previous purchases. This helps sales, marketing, and support teams deliver more personalized and meaningful experiences, leading to stronger relationships and higher customer satisfaction.

Increased Sales and Revenue : By managing leads more effectively and automating key parts of the sales process, CRM systems help sales teams close deals faster and increase conversion rates. Features like lead scoring, follow-up reminders, and sales pipeline tracking allow teams to focus on the most promising opportunities.

Better Data and Reporting : CRM platforms consolidate customer data in one place and offer real-time dashboards and analytics. This helps businesses make more informed decisions, identify trends, measure campaign performance, and forecast future sales accurately.

Enhanced Collaboration Across Teams : A CRM system ensures that all customer-facing departments—sales, marketing, and service—have access to the same up-to-date information. This breaks down silos and improves communication between teams, allowing them to coordinate better and serve customers more efficiently.

Automation of Repetitive Tasks : CRM tools can automate routine tasks such as sending follow-up emails, updating records, assigning leads, or generating reports. This reduces human error, increases productivity, and allows teams to focus on higher-value activities like closing sales or resolving complex customer issues.

More Effective Marketing : CRM systems help marketing teams create targeted campaigns based on customer segmentation, behavior, and past interactions. They can track the performance of campaigns and measure ROI, enabling better planning and optimization of future marketing efforts.

Improved Customer Retention : By tracking customer interactions and setting reminders for follow-ups, CRM tools help businesses stay engaged with their existing customers. Features like loyalty tracking, service case management, and satisfaction surveys contribute to long-term customer loyalty

Better Customer Service : Support teams can quickly access customer histories, preferences, and past issues. This enables faster, more accurate responses and increases first-contact resolution rates, leading to higher customer satisfaction.

Scalability and Flexibility : As your business grows, a CRM can scale with you—handling more customers, users, and complex workflows. Many CRM platforms offer modular features or integrations with other tools like email, accounting, or helpdesk systems.

What Is ERP? (Enterprise Resource Planning)

Enterprise Resource Planning (ERP) is a type of business management software that helps organizations integrate and manage their core processes within a unified system. It streamlines operations by automating and coordinating functions like finance, human resources, supply chain, manufacturing, procurement, inventory, and more.

erp software

ERP systems serve as the central nervous system of a business, connecting various departments through shared data and workflows. This integration helps ensure that information flows consistently across the organization, reduces duplication of effort, and enhances decision-making.

Core Functions of ERP Systems

ERP software typically includes modules for:

  • Financial management – accounting, budgeting, and reporting

  • Human resources – payroll, hiring, performance tracking

  • Inventory and warehouse management – stock tracking and optimization

  • Procurement and purchasing – managing vendors and purchase orders

  • Manufacturing and production – planning, scheduling, and quality control

  • Supply chain and logistics – order fulfillment, shipping, and distribution

  • Project management – time tracking, resource allocation, and milestones

ERP Benefits

Here is a detailed list of the benefits of ERP (Enterprise Resource Planning) systems, organized into clear, informative points:

Centralized Data and Unified System : ERP systems integrate all core business functions into a single platform with one centralized database. This eliminates data silos, reduces duplication of information, and ensures that every department—from finance to HR to logistics—is working with real-time, accurate data.

Improved Operational Efficiency : ERP automates routine and time-consuming tasks such as invoicing, payroll processing, order management, and inventory tracking. This streamlines workflows, reduces manual errors, and boosts overall productivity across departments.

Real-Time Reporting and Analytics : ERP systems offer powerful dashboards and reporting tools that provide real-time insights into business performance. Managers can access up-to-date information on inventory, sales, expenses, and profitability to make faster, data-driven decisions.

Cost Savings : By improving efficiency, reducing errors, and automating processes, ERP helps businesses lower operational costs. It minimizes the need for redundant systems, manual work, and unproductive overhead—especially over the long term.

Enhanced Collaboration Between Departments : ERP fosters better communication and collaboration by giving all departments access to the same, consistent data. For example, sales and inventory teams can coordinate on stock availability, while finance can instantly pull data from other units for budgeting and compliance.

Better Inventory and Supply Chain Management : ERP systems track inventory in real time, helping businesses reduce excess stock, avoid shortages, and improve warehouse operations. It can also optimize the supply chain, ensuring timely purchasing, production, and delivery.

Improved Compliance and Risk Management : ERP software often includes features for auditing, reporting, and tracking regulatory requirements (e.g., tax laws, labor regulations). This helps businesses stay compliant and reduces the risk of costly violations or fraud.

Scalability for Business Growth : Modern ERP systems are designed to scale with a business. Whether you expand to new locations, add more users, or increase product lines, ERP can accommodate growth with minimal disruption.

Better Data Security : ERP systems often come with advanced security controls, including user permissions, encryption, and audit trails. Centralized data management also reduces the risks associated with using multiple disconnected software systems.

Increased Agility and Responsiveness : By having a clear, real-time view of business operations, organizations can respond quickly to market changes, supply chain disruptions, or customer demands. ERP provides the flexibility and agility to adapt to challenges and opportunities more effectively.

Enhanced Strategic Planning : With consolidated insights across departments, ERP supports better forecasting, budgeting, and strategic decision-making. Leaders can use these insights to align operations with long-term goals.

Customization and Integration : Many ERP platforms are modular and customizable, allowing companies to tailor the system to their unique processes. ERP can also integrate with third-party tools (e.g., CRM, e-commerce, HR platforms), extending its capabilities.

CRM vs. ERP: Understanding Key Differences

Customer Relationship Management (CRM) and Enterprise Resource Planning (ERP) are both powerful enterprise systems that help businesses improve performance, but they serve very different functions. CRM is primarily focused on managing external relationships—specifically customer interactions—and is used by sales, marketing, and customer service teams to increase revenue, enhance customer satisfaction, and build long-term loyalty. It helps businesses track leads, manage sales pipelines, automate marketing campaigns, and resolve support issues efficiently.

In contrast, ERP is designed to manage internal operations by integrating back-office functions such as finance, human resources, inventory, procurement, and supply chain management. Its purpose is to streamline workflows, reduce operational costs, and ensure consistency across departments by unifying all business processes into a centralized system.

While both CRM and ERP automate tasks and consolidate data, CRM improves how businesses attract and retain customers, making it a revenue-generating tool. ERP, on the other hand, enhances internal efficiency, making it a cost-saving solution. The two systems support different users—CRM for front-line teams engaging with customers, and ERP for internal teams managing business operations. However, they are not mutually exclusive; many companies benefit from using both in tandem. When integrated, CRM and ERP provide a complete view of both customer interactions and operational performance, enabling smarter decisions and more seamless execution from initial contact to final delivery and reporting.

CRM and ERP Integration

CRM and ERP integration refers to the process of connecting a company’s customer-facing system (CRM) with its internal business operations system (ERP), allowing data to flow seamlessly between the two. This integration creates a unified platform where information entered in one system—such as a new customer lead, order, or service request—is automatically reflected in the other. For example, when a sales team closes a deal in the CRM, the ERP system can immediately process the order, update inventory, generate an invoice, and schedule delivery, all without manual data entry. This eliminates data duplication, reduces errors, and ensures that both customer-facing and back-office teams are working from the same, up-to-date information.

Integrating CRM and ERP enhances collaboration between departments, shortens response times, and improves the overall customer experience. Sales teams gain visibility into inventory availability, pricing, and delivery timelines from the ERP, while finance and operations teams can view customer payment history and order status from the CRM. This holistic view supports better forecasting, more accurate reporting, and faster decision-making. Integration also improves workflow automation—triggering alerts, actions, or reports across systems without the need for manual intervention. While some companies use third-party middleware to bridge separate CRM and ERP platforms, others choose integrated solutions from vendors like Microsoft Dynamics 365, Oracle, or SAP that offer both systems in a unified suite.

In today’s fast-paced and data-driven environment, CRM and ERP integration is no longer a luxury but a strategic necessity for companies looking to scale efficiently, boost customer satisfaction, and maintain competitive advantage.

👉Best CRM Pricing

👉Use Case Of CRM